Welcome!

Our transformed building on Capitol Hill is open after a major multi-year building renovation that allows us to share more of our collection and resources than ever before.

The transformed Folger features two new exhibition halls, a learning lab, welcoming gardens, collaborative research spaces, and expanded visitor amenities such as a new café and gift shop.

Along with our new public wing, the Folger’s historic spaces, including the Reading Room, are also reopening.
